The clear #1 WR in the draft most likely won't workout at all before the draft. This is the same injury Jonathan Stewart had last season before the draft.

Most impressive thing I've seen so far

David Buehler, 6’2" 227lb Kicker with 25 bench press reps. More than two of the top OT prospects, Monroe and Oher.

I think he'll be fine

The evidence of how good is he is on the tape. In fact, I think this could help him in a way if it comes out he was playing the season with it. I saw somewhere that his injury was reaggravated at the Cotton Bowl. So if he was playing part of the season on a banged up leg, to me that answered any questions someone might have about his toughness.
